Output 26604266f36e520b5a4ea86f51fe0de5a0f3acdd4b96aad84196d1cc868258fd:0

value
920674
script pubkey
OP_0 OP_PUSHBYTES_32 293340e5f44215981294336000e30c3527b9006fde8dd5087923421dfd37d6ba
address
bc1q9ye5pe05gg2esy55xdsqpccvx5nmjqr0m6xa2zreydppmlfh66aqudr5jy
transaction
26604266f36e520b5a4ea86f51fe0de5a0f3acdd4b96aad84196d1cc868258fd
confirmations
258716
spent
true